#13 Northwestern vs. #18 Michigan

Kickoff at 2:30pm EST

TV: Big Ten Network

This is an intriguing matchup. Northwestern's win over Stanford to start the year looks better and better each week. How they held the Cardinal to 6 points, when they're averaging 46ppg against Pac12 competition so far, is beyond me. It's hard to buy Northwestern being good, since it's hard for me to buy any B1G team being that great this year, plus they're the Duke of the B1G, but they just keep winning. Michigan's only loss on the season was a close one to a still-undefeated Utah team. Michigan has only given up two touchdowns in four games since then and has pitched two shutouts in a row. Is Michigan for real? It's hard to know. Is Northwestern for real? It's hard to believe. Will this game give us any clarity, regardless of who wins? It's hard to imagine. Mich 31 - NW 17
